Rediff Launches Mobile ComicsRediff.com the leading online community portal today announced the launch of the legendary ‘Diamond Comics’ on  mobile phones. Now any one can enjoy their favorite comics on GSM-GPRS enable Mobile Phone no matter where you are or which is your service provider.

Diamond Comics has created magic over the decades, with its beautifully woven stories and classic characters, adding quality fuel to the comic industry. Chacha Chaudhary, Billoo, Pinky, Sabu, Raaka are names that have become legends in the history of print entertainment. And now all of Diamond Comics' titles are exclusively provided for users on their mobile phone by Rediff.com.




Any one can enjoy reading Diamond Comics on GPRS enabled mobile handsets. The service can be accessed in 3 easy steps i.e. Access http://mobile.rediff.com/comic, select your favorite title and read the comics for which you will be charged Rs 10/- by your respective telecom operator for a 24 hrs session for unlimited access to all the comics from the library. To subscribe by SMS just send ‘Chacha’ to 57333.

The Subscriber can enjoy the wide range of titles of Chacha Chaudhary, Billoo, Pinky, Phanton, Shaktimaan to the all-time favorite comics digests like Panchatantra, Tenalirama, Vikram Betal, Akbar Birbal, Ramayan & Mahabharat etc.
